Investment Banking to Consulting?

Hey guys, so banking and consulting recruiting is entirely over at my school. I'm currently deciding between a second-tier consulting firm (Deloitte/OW/LEK) versus IBD at a GS/JPM/MS bulge-bracket. This is for summer 2018 (I am a junior now). I ultimately want to enter consulting at some point and do not want to stay in banking long-term. The goal is MBB, and I will be recruiting for MBB during full-time recruiting during the next cycle. Would IBD at a top bulge-bracket like GS/JPM/MS or second-tier consulting at Deloitte/OW/LEK put me in the best position for MBB for full-time recruiting? I was thinking that while Deloitte/OW/LEK would obviously have the most transferrable skills and give me direct consulting experience for MBB, the top IBD names on my resume might be better. Appreciate any advice!
